Florida Attorney General Launches Investigation Into Fauci

Florida Attorney General James Uthmeier said the probe seeks answers after Anthony Fauci invoked the Fifth Amendment multiple times before senators.

  • On Wednesday, Florida Attorney General James Uthmeier announced his office is opening an investigation into Anthony Fauci, citing the former health official's "lack of candor to Congress."
  • The investigation follows a Senate Homeland Security and Governmental Affairs Committee hearing where Fauci invoked his Fifth Amendment right over 100 times, while Sen. Rand Paul released over 1,000 pages of his diary.
  • Florida Republicans, including Gov. Ron DeSantis and Sen. Rick Scott, criticized Fauci's pandemic handling. Rep. Anna Paulina Luna urged state officials to pursue charges, arguing that federal pardons do not shield Fauci from state-level prosecution.
  • Sen. Paul stated he will hold a vote next week on whether to declare Fauci in contempt of Congress, while Fauci maintained silence on legal advice fearing prosecution.
  • Although President Joe Biden granted Fauci an unconditional pardon in January 2025 for federal offenses, Uthmeier and other state officials maintain this does not prevent state-level investigations, leaving the pardon's scope a central legal question.
